RESOLUTION NO. 87-18823
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F
MIAMI BEACH, FLORIDA, AUTHORIZING ACCEPTANCE OF A
SETTLEMENT OFFER WITH ISAAC SURUJON AND
MATILDA SURUJON, HIS WIFE, IN THE AMOUNT OF $70,000.00
FOR THE ACQUISITION OF THE EAST 100.06 FEET OF LOT 7,
BLOCK 100, OCEAN BEACH ADDITION NO.3, PLAT BOOK 2,
PAGE 81, PUBLIC RECORDS OF DADE COUNTY, FLORIDA, AT
312 MICHIGAN AVENUE FOR THE SOUTH BEACH ELEMENTARY
SCHOOL LAND ACQUISITION PROJECT.
B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I
BEACH, FLORIDA;
W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Miami Beach is desirous of
purchasing property surrounding the Dade County School Board property located in the
redevelopment area;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Miami Beach adopted Resolution
No. 86-18369 on February 5, 1986, authorizing the City Manager to initiate procedures for
clearance of bond funds to purchase the property surrounding the South Beach Elementary
School;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ission authorized the City Attorney and the City
Manager to proceed with negotiations and methods to accomplish the purchase;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Miami Beach adopted Resolution
No. 86-18563 on September 3, 1986, appropriating $2,300,000 in available funds from the
reallocation of bond funds to the South Beach Elementary School Land Acquisition Project;
and
WHEREAS, the City Commission of the City of Miami Beach adopted Resolution
No. 86-18712 on December 17, 1986, authorizing execution of the Acquisition Agreement
between the City of Miami Beach and the Dade County School Boa~Ct-for the approved
expansion and reopening of the South Beach Elementary School; and
WHEREAS, the City Administration has negotiated the purchase price of
$70,000.00 for the described property; and
WHEREAS, the funding for this project is to be taken from the reallocation of
bond funds in the South Beach Elementary SCh~1 Land Acquisition Project
Work Order No. 2970. \
NOW, TH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E
CITY OF MIAMI BEACH, FLORIDA, THAT:
1. The recommendation of the City Manager and staff as to the purchase price
of $70,000.00 for the east 100.06 feet of Lot 7, Block 100, Ocean Beach Addition No.3, Plat
Book 2, Page 81, Public Records of Dade County, Florida for the South Beach Elementary
School Land Acquisition Project is hereby accepted and approved.
2. The funds in the amount of $70,000.00 be taken from the South Beach
Elementary School Land Acquisition Project Work Order No. 2970.
PASSED and ADOPTED this 15th day of Aoril 1987.

OFFER FOR SALE
In consideration of the sum of $10.00, receipt of which is hereby acknowledged, we
hereby offer to sell to the City of Miami Beach, for the price of seventy thousand ($70,000)
Dollars, the following described property commonly known as: 312 Michigan Avenue, Miami
Beach, Florida.
Legally described as:
East 100.06 feet of Lot 7, Block 100, Ocean Beach Addition NO.3, Plat Book
2/81.
The sum of seventy thousand ($70,000) Dollars is compensation in full for the described
property, free of all encumbrances, including liens, mortgages, judgments, contracts for the
payment of money, real estate taxes and other governmental levies for all prior years.
Seller shall be responsible for documentary stamps, including surtax, and his own attorneys
fees. Real estate taxes and prepaid rents shall be prorated to the date of closing. A,ll
improvements on the described property are included in this offer.
This offer for sale is made on the understanding that eminent domain proceedings are
about to be instituted as to this property; consequently, this agreement is made to forestall
protracted litigation.
We understand that this offer is subject to approval of the City Commission of the
City of Miami Beach and it can be accepted only by payment to me. Delivery of possession
shall be within fifteen (15) days after payment of the above amount unless written consent
to an extension is received.
This sale is subject to the following special conditions:
1. The seller reserves the right to remove all personal property and appliances from
the prentises prior to demolition of the premises.
2. The foregoing is subject to tenants in possession and such leases as the tenants
may have. Seller agrees not to enter into any written leases after the date of this
offer.
3. Seller's delivery of good and marketable Title.
This offer for sale is irrevocable for a period of thirty (30) days from this date.

SUBJECT: AUTHORIZING THE ACCEPTANCE OF A SETTLEMENT OFFER WITH
ISAAC SURUJON AND MATILDA SURUJON, HIS WIPE, FOR THE
ACQUISmON OF 312 MICmGAN A VENUE, MIAMI BEACH, FLORIDA,
IN THE SOUTH BEACH ELEMENTARY SCHOOL LAND ACQUISITION
PROJECT
BACKGROUND:
The City Commission of the City of Miami Beach adopted Resolution No. 86-18369 on
February 5, 1986, authorizing the City Manager to initiate procedures for the clearance of
bond funds to purchase the property surrounding the South Beach Elementary School, and
further, authorized the City Attorney and the City Manager to proceed with negotiations to
purchase the various properties designated for the South Beach Elementary School Land
Acquisition Project.
CURRENT STATUS:
The City Administration has met with Mr. and Mrs. Isaac SuruJon, owners of the property
located at 312 Michigan Avenue, Miami Beach, Florida (the east 100.06 feet of Lot 7,
Block 100, Ocean Beach Addition No.3, Plat Book 2, Page 81, Public Records of Dade
County, Florida). The negotiations with the property owners has resulted in an offer in the
amount of $70,000.00 (copy of offer attached).
The Land Use and Development Committee, at its meeting of Monday, April 6, 1987,
reviewed the proposed offer and recommended the approval of the acquisition of the
property.
ADMINISTRATION RECOMMENDATION:
The City Administration recommends that the City Commission approve the settlement
offer and adopt the attached Resolution authorizing the acquisition of 312 Michigan Avenue,
Miami Beach, Florida, the east 100.06 feet of Lot 7, Block 100, Ocean Beach Addition No.3,
Plat Book 2, Page 81, Public Records of Dade County, Florida, for $70,000.00. Funds to be
taken from the South Beach Elementary School Land Acquisition I'~oject
Work Order No. 2970.
